Step 1: Define the Task Clearly

Start by understanding exactly what you want the AI to do. Break down your task into specific components. For example, instead of asking, “Help me with invoicing,” specify, “Generate an invoice template for a client who purchased 10 units of product X at $50 each, with payment due in 30 days.”

Step 2: Use Precise Language

Be clear and detailed in your instructions. Avoid ambiguous terms. Use concrete details, such as names, dates, quantities, and other relevant information. This helps the AI understand exactly what you need and reduces the chance of errors.

Step 3: Include Context When Necessary

Providing context helps the AI generate more relevant responses. For example, if you want a social media post, mention the platform, target audience, and tone. Example: “Create a friendly Facebook post promoting our new product to local customers.”

Step 4: Specify the Format and Details

Indicate the preferred format for the response. Do you want a list, a paragraph, or bullet points? Specify any specific details, such as including a call-to-action or particular keywords.

Step 5: Review and Refine Your Prompt

Test your prompt and review the output. If it’s not quite right, adjust the wording for clarity or add more details. Iterative refinement helps you develop prompts that consistently produce useful results.

Example Prompts for Small Business Tasks

  • Scheduling: “Create a weekly schedule for my small retail store, including opening hours, staff shifts, and break times.”
  • Customer Service: “Draft a polite response to a customer complaint about delayed delivery, offering a solution.”
  • Invoicing: “Generate an invoice template for a wholesale order of 500 units of product Y, with payment terms of net 45 days.”
  • Social Media: “Write a professional LinkedIn post announcing our new service for local businesses.”
